| Freedom for Victims Foundation OUR PRINCIPLES At the Freedom For Victims Foundation, we recognize some common sense basic principles about the way the Constitution of the United States works in the real world. First off, as Bob Dylan said, “Money doesn’t talk. It swears.” Second, and most important, Saul Alinsky, the man who trained Fred Ross (who in turn trained Alan Cranston, Cesar Chavez, Nicholas Von Hoffman, Dolores Huerta and many, many others), put it succinctly: “Power goes to two poles: to those who’ve got the money and to those who’ve got the people.” We are dedicated to the principle of equal access to justice regardless of race, creed, color, sex, sexual orientation, political belief and national origin. We believe that the rights guaranteed by the Constitution of the United States are elucidated, enumerated, and illustrated by the International Covenant on Civil & Political Rights.
